Red light therapy, also known as low-level laser therapy (LLLT) or photobiomodulation, involves the use of red or near-infrared light to stimulate cellular repair and promote healing. The light penetrates the skin, reaching the mitochondria of the cells where it promotes the production of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the energy source for cellular processes. This, in turn, leads to an increase in collagen and elastin production, which are essential for maintaining the youthfulness and elasticity of the skin.
There are various benefits of red light therapy for the skin. Firstly, it can help re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les, making the skin look smoother and more youthful. Additionally, it can improve skin tone and texture, reducing redness, pigmentation, and acne scars. Red light therapy also has anti-inflammatory properties, making it beneficial for those with conditions such as rosacea or eczema. Furthermore, it can promote wound healing and reduce the appearance of stretch marks.

Key Considerations when Choosing a Red Light Therapy Mask
1. Wavelengths and Power Output: When it comes to red light therapy, the specific wavelengths and power output of the device are crucial. Red light therapy masks typically emit light in the red (630-700nm) and near-infrared (700-850nm) spectrum. It's important to choose a mask that offers a sufficient power output to penetrate the skin and provide therapeutic benefits. Look for masks that have a high number of LEDs and adjustable power settings for customizable treatments.
2. Coverage Area: Consider the coverage area of the red light therapy mask to ensure that it can effectively target the entire face or specific problem areas. Masks with a larger surface area can provide more comprehensive treatment and may be more beneficial for individuals with widespread skin concerns.
3. Build Quality and Comfort: Since red light therapy masks are worn directly on the face, it's essential to prioritize build quality and comfort. Look for masks made from durable materials that are lightweight and comfortable to wear for extended periods. Adjustable straps and ergonomic designs can also enhance the overall user experience.
4. Treatment Modes and Customization: Some red light therapy masks offer multiple treatment modes and customizable settings to cater to different skin concerns. Masks with different intensity levels, pulsation patterns, and pre-programmed treatments can provide a more tailored approach to addressing specific skin issues.
